水力喷射径向钻井研究及其在碳酸盐岩储层中的应用  被引量:2

Research of Hydraulic Jet Radial Drilling and Its Application in Carbonate Reservoir

摘  要:水力喷射径向钻井技术是一种有效开发低渗边际油藏、边底水薄层油藏、枯竭油气田剩余油气资源的低成本的增产完井技术。在低油价的新常态下,为了探索低渗薄层碳酸盐岩储层的有效开发方式,通过对水力喷射径向钻井技术原理、优势、存在问题的调研和研究,结合选井选层分析、施工方案优化与过程质量控制,圆满完成水力喷射径向钻井技术在碳酸盐岩储层中的试验应用。过程分析表明,在碳酸盐岩储层中实施径向钻井时喷射软管磨损大;使用酸液喷射钻进一方面能增加径向钻进进尺,另一方面也容易形成杂质影响施工进程;作为喷射的工作液必须达到无固相的要求。Hydraulic jet radial drilling technology is a low-cost increasing production and completion technology for the effective development of low-permeability marginal reservoirs,thin-layer reservoirs with edge-bottom water,and depleted oil and gas fields.Under the new normal of low oil price,in order to explore the effective development method of thin layer carbonate reservoirs of low permeability,the pilot of hydraulic jet radial drilling technology in the carbonate reservoir test application was successfully completed through the research on the principle,advantage and existing problems of radial jet drilling and the combination of the layers optimization,the process quality control.The process analysis of the successful pilot shows that the jet hose wear is more serious when the radial drilling is carried out in the carbonate reservoir.The use of acid jet drilling can increase the radial drilling footage on the one hand and the formation of impurities on the other hand.At the same time the jetting fluid must meet the requirements of non-solid phase.
